Table 1 Characteristics of each of the three buildings.

From: Comprehensive energy demand and usage data for building automation

Usage type

UMAR

DFAB

SolAce

residential

residential

meeting room / office

Rooms (Bold font shows the rooms which are included in this publication)

Entry, living room / kitchen (nr. 273), two bedrooms (nr. 272, 274) and two bathrooms.

Living room, dining area (nr. 371), two lounges (nr. 474, 573), four bedrooms (nr. 472, 476, 571, 574), each with a private bath.

Office space, meeting space.

Total area

155m2

240m2

103m2

Date of construction

02.2018

02.2019

09.2018

Building technology

Ceiling heating/cooling, high temperature domestic water storage tank.

Photovoltaic panel, heat pump boiler, floor heating/cooling, automatic ventilation, heat recovery from hot water.

Photovoltaic panel, solar thermal panel, ceiling heating/cooling, automatic ventilation, window shading, domestic hot water and storage.

Occupant related information

Window openings, temperature set point for heating/cooling, domestic hot water consumption, total electricity consumption.

Temperature set point for heating/cooling, total electricity consumption and electricity consumption of the kitchen, water consumption showers.

Movement sensor for presence detection, Position of blinds, temperature set point for heating/cooling.

Construction

Roof and floor construction with a wood beam layer insulated with rock wool and a vapor barrier. Ventilated façade with a wood beam layer insulated with rock wool and a vapor barrier. The window front is triple glazed.

Three-story house with flat roof. The 1st floor wood beam construction is insulated with rock wool and two triple glazed glass facades. The 2nd and 3rd floor wood beam structure is insulated with aerogel.

Roof and floor construction with a wood beam layer insulated with rock wool and a vapor barrier. Ventilated façade with a wood beam layer insulated with rock wool and a vapor barrier. The window front is triple glazed.

  1. Room numbers in brackets foster comparisons with the sketch in Fig. 2. More detailed information on the sensor types and the exact measurements is contained in Table 2.
